In the reaction N₂O₄(g) ⇌ 2NO₂(g), what is the correct expression for Kp?
A. Kp = pN₂O₄ / (pNO₂)²
B. Kp = (pNO₂)² / pN₂O₄
C. Kp = pN₂O₄ × (pNO₂)²
D. Kp = pNO₂ / pN₂O₄
